Over the previous few weeks, Elon Musk and Brazil’s Supreme Courtroom Justice Alexandre de Moraes have been exchanging barbs over pretend information and hate speech proliferation on X, the social media platform previously often called Twitter. Right this moment, the highest courtroom has ordered an instantaneous suspension of X’s companies within the nation and has additionally levied a hefty effective for anybody making an attempt to entry the platform utilizing VPN companies, experiences the Related Press.

The order to ban X within the nation comes after the courtroom gave the social media firm a deadline for appointing a neighborhood authorized consultant to supervise its operations within the nation. Following the courtroom’s order, Brazil’s Nationwide Telecommunications Company has began limiting entry, and has requested Google and Apple to delist the cellular app from Play Retailer and App Retailer, respectively.

Earlier this month, X shuttered its workplace in Brazil citing threats of an arrest made in opposition to its nation consultant in the event that they did not adjust to sure content material orders given by the federal government. The social media platform did not adjust to requests for taking applicable motion in opposition to accounts that have been allegedly engaged in spreading misinformation, whereas arguing that it will not bow all the way down to censorship.

VPNs can be an dear folly

With the ban coming into impact, many customers would possibly naturally gravitate towards utilizing a VPN service to avoid the block and entry the social media platform. However in his order, Choose Moraes talked about a effective price 50,000 Brazilian reals (roughly $8,900) for any individual or entity discovered utilizing VPNs to go to X in opposition to the country-wide suspension order. That effective is just not a one-time cost. As an alternative, the hefty penalty will likely be levied on a per-day foundation.

Again in April, Musk instructed X customers in Brazil just do that. “To make sure that you would be able to nonetheless entry the 𝕏 platform, obtain a digital non-public community (VPN) app,” he wrote in a submit. The difficulty of VPNs has been fairly contentious. On one hand, journalists and human rights activists want it in order that they’ll keep away from snooping, however governments’ stand differs. In lots of nations, utilizing VPNs to avoid a ban quantities to a violation of native telecom legal guidelines, and will be punishable with fines in addition to police motion.

X, however, apparently anticipated the order. “Not like different social media and know-how platforms, we won’t comply in secret with unlawful orders,” X shared in a assertion forward of the courtroom order. Along with X, the courtroom has additionally acted in opposition to Starlink, Musk’s satellite tv for pc web firm. “In an uncommon transfer, Justice Moraes additionally froze the funds of one other Musk enterprise in Brazil, SpaceX’s Starlink satellite-internet service, to attempt to accumulate fines he has levied in opposition to X,” experiences The New York Instances.
